Given in the Āṭānāṭiya Sutta as the name of the ninety-one sons of Dhataraṭṭha, king of the Gandhabbā. They are represented as being of great strength and followers of the Buddha (D.iii.197).
The name is also given as that of the ninety-one sons of Virūḷha, king of the Kumbhaṇḍā (D.iii.198); of Virūpakkha, king of the Nāgā (p.199); and of Kuvera, king of the Yakkhā (p.202). Further on in the same sutta, Inda is mentioned with Soma, Varuṇa and others as a yakkha, to whom appeal should be made by disciples of the Buddha when needing protection (p.204).
In the Mahāsamaya Sutta (D.ii.257 f), also, Inda is mentioned as the name of the Sons of the Regent Gods of the Four Quarters.
